Transaction 3d80c1597653260cb18afbc9dd6f1c569bd6ffb9993691bd321dbdd2c559da77
1 Input
1 Output
-
3d80c1597653260cb18afbc9dd6f1c569bd6ffb9993691bd321dbdd2c559da77:0
- value
- 22243908
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fd7fd53f42f826d2fad755bdc2cbd45351f8932 OP_EQUAL
- address
- 3N6bMYGCqezSSVywxzh4ru7iy8j8wCLSQU